The Family Chase: All about The Chase’s new spin-off show

The Chase’s new spin off The Family Chase begins tonight and her’s all you need to know.

Advertisements

Starting tonight at 6PM on ITV, each show of The Family Chase features a different family trying to stay one step ahead of the chaser for the opportunity to win a cash pot worth thousands.

The four contestants will each answer a series of general knowledge questions as they attempt to get their tactics right and make it into the final chase, where they will then face the chaser once again for the chance to walk away with the prize.

Chasers Anne ‘The Governess’ Hegerty, Mark ‘The Beast’ Labbett, Shaun ‘The Dark Destroyer’ Wallace, Paul ‘The Sinnerman’ Sinha and Jenny ‘The Vixen’ Ryan will be doing their best to ensure they leave with nothing.

Host Bradley said: “Let four members of a family loose on The Chase and you get The Family Chase. What we quickly discovered was that families aren’t frightened to say what they mean and mean what they say.

“Imagine anything you’ve said to your family whilst you’re watching our show, in the privacy of your front room, well, these families take it into the studio. There’s none of the usual ‘just come back, we want you in the final chase’ it’s ‘if you go low, you can forget Christmas at my house’.

“If the Walsh family appeared as a team, that’s exactly what we’d say. There’d be no soft soaping that’s for sure!

“I loved making The Family Chase, and with this twist on the format you’ll love it too!”

As for The Chasers, they said the experience was also quite eye opening.

Anne said: “The kids are likely to be fast on the buzzer and know their pop culture. The dads know the classic quiz stuff, but can be out buzzed by their children jumping in to pass! Mums and nans are the ones being cautious about the offers: ‘Don’t go high!’”

Jenny added: “I think the trickiest combinations on the teams are brothers and sisters of any age – because of the sibling rivalry they are always trying to prove a point. I faced a family from Essex which included a grown-up brother and sister – they were throwing more insults at each other than Brad’s had hot dinners!”

And Mark quipped: “Nans. They know weird stuff.”
